Scarlet Enclave Will Be Progressively Easier Starting June 3 in Season of Discovery

With the next weekly maintenance on June 3rd, Blizzard will be making some adjustments to the Scarlet Enclave raid in Season of Discovery. The changes come as Blizzard has implemented a way to earn a level 85 character boost in the raid for the incoming Mists of Pandaria expansion on Classic progression realms.

All player characters will receive a 5% buff to their damage, healing, and health in the raid, which will increase by an additional 5% every two weeks, maxing out at 25% total. This is similar to the buffs that were offered in the Icecrown Citadel and Dragon Soul raids on Classic progression realms.

With that information, here is the schedule for the buff increases:

  • June 3: 5%
  • June 17: 10%
  • July 1: 15%
  • July 15: 20%
  • July 29: 25%

Given these dates, you’ll be able to capitalize on the 10% buff to earn your character boost before the cutoff date. The final 25% buff will land just a week after the Mists of Pandaria expansion launches for Classic progression realms.

Kaivax – (Source)

With scheduled weekly maintenance next week, we will begin to adjust Scarlet Enclave in Season of Discovery. Starting on June 3:

  • Player-characters in Scarlet Enclave will receive a 5% increase to their damage, healing, and health.
  • This will increase by 5% every two weeks.
  • There will be a maximum of 25% increased damage, healing, and health.
